Ingredients

  • 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ese
  • 1 egg
  • ⅓ cup white sugar
  • ⅛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up white sugar
  • ¼ cup cocoa
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up water
  • ⅓ cup vegetable oil
  • 1 tablespoon distilled white v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Information

  • Servings: 24
  • Yield: 18 to 24 servings

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ly butter muffin tins and set aside.
  • Beat together the cream cheese, egg, sugar and salt. Stir in chocolate chips and set aside.
  • In a separate bowl, sift together the flour, sugar, cocoa, baking soda and salt. Add the water, oil, vinegar, and vanilla. Beat until well combined. Batter will be thin.
  • Fill muffin cups 1/3 full with the chocolate batter. Top each one with a spoonful of cream cheese mixture.
  • Bake for 30 to 35 minutes.
